It involves using an electric … WebSimply put, gel electrophoresis uses positive and negative charges to separate charged particles. Particles can be positively charged, negatively charged, or neutral. Charged particles are attracted to opposite charges: Positively charged particles are attracted to negative charges Negatively charged particles are attracted to positive charges
